一聚教程网:一个值得你收藏的教程网站

最新下载

热门教程

hadoop-hbase性能调优实战指南

时间:2026-05-20 11:00:02 编辑:袖梨 来源:一聚教程网

作为Hadoop生态中的重要组件,HBase凭借其分布式架构和列式存储特性,为大数据应用提供了高效解决方案。掌握以下优化技巧可显著提升数据库性能。

hadoop hbase如何进行调优

HBase调优方法

  1. 客户端层面建议采用scan缓存优化策略,通过批量get请求提升效率,精确指定查询列族,离线读取时关闭缓存功能。
  2. 服务器端需平衡读请求分布,配置合适的blockcache参数,重点监控缓存命中率、配置项状态及GC日志分析。
  3. 内存分配应将70%可用内存划为Java堆,同时需警惕过大堆内存引发的GC延迟问题。
  4. CPU资源优化重点在于合理使用过滤器,有效降低计算资源消耗。
  5. 数据模型设计需要优化表结构,科学设计行键,实施预分区和表预分割策略。
  6. 采用批量处理机制减少网络传输,包括批量写入和批量读取操作。
  7. 启用压缩技术降低I/O压力,正确配置Block Cache与Bloom Filter参数。
  8. 运用HBase Web UI和JMX等监控工具持续跟踪集群性能指标。

HBase配置参数优化建议

  1. 优化内存参数配置,适当扩大堆内存规模并缩短垃圾回收周期。
  2. 扩充写入缓冲区容量,激活批量写入功能。
  3. 提升缓存空间配置,开启数据压缩功能。
  4. 制定科学的预分区方案,动态调整RegionServer数量。

综合运用这些优化手段能显著改善HBase运行效率。实际应用中需根据具体业务需求灵活调整参数,通过持续测试获取最佳性能配置方案。

热门栏目